How Safe Is Klim Formula Milk Powder For A 6 Month Old Infant?

My baby is 5 months old she going to turn 6 months end of this month. I want to know if I could feed my baby klim powder milk. I am looking for different options, because I hear that rice cereal would get her constipated. I just want something that could get her full for longer periods of time. She drink formula 5 or 6 onz and she is feeding every 3 to 4 hours.

General & Family Physician 's  Response
Hi,

Klim is usually for older children and would not give her the nutrients that she needs at this stage.

Cereals contain fiber which promotes bowel movements so the rice cereal is fine for a start or introduction to food.
Important to remember that she still needs milk most of all because it would help with brain growth and development but if she takes the cereal then can start slowly with other foods.
